1. Describe the changing trend of the function: Limit can help us understand the behavior of the function near a certain point, so as to better understand the properties and characteristics of the function. For example, we can use limits to study the continuity, differentiability and monotonicity of functions.
2. Calculate the function value: By calculating the limit, the value of the function at a certain point can be calculated, which is very important for solving practical problems. For example, in physics, we often need to calculate the speed or acceleration of an object at a certain point.
3. Derivation formula: Limit also plays an important role in the derivation of mathematical formula. For example, Taylor formula is a method to approximate the solution of complex function through limit. In addition, some important limit theorems, such as L 'Bida Law and Pinch Theorem, are also based on the concept of limit.
4. Establish calculus theory: Limit is the basis of calculus theory. Calculus mainly includes differential calculus and integral calculus, both of which are defined and deduced by limit. For example, the derivative is the tangent slope of the function at a certain point, and the integral is the area under the function curve.
5. Solving practical problems: Limit also plays an important role in solving practical problems. For example, in economics, we often need to calculate marginal costs and marginal benefits; In biology, we need to consider the population growth rate and so on. These problems can be solved by limits.
In a word, limit plays an important role in mathematical analysis, which provides a powerful tool for us to study the properties of functions, calculate their values, derive formulas, establish calculus theory and solve practical problems.
